numerator

numerator - noun

  • The part of a fraction that is above the line and signifies the number to be divided by the denominator
  • One that numbers

Etymology

Latin

Borrowed from Middle French & Late Latin; Middle French numerateur, borrowed from Late Latin numerātor "counter, enumerator," from Latin numerāre "to count, number:2" + -tor, agent suffix

Word family

numerate, numerical
